Obituary for LaKisha Knight
LaKisha Shantise Knight “Tee Tee”, daughter of Reba K. Berkley and the late Alvin “Hootley” Knight, was born September 30, 1980.  Our beautiful Angel departed this life on the morning of October 21, 2015.
In addition to her father, she was preceded in death by her brothers, Renaldo “Rico” Grant and Ricky Knight; and stepfather, Lewis Berkley.
Tee Tee received her education from the Nottoway County School System.  After graduating, she received her CNA certification and worked in the Nottoway and Newport News areas.
Tee Tee received Christ at an early age.  She was initially a member of Union Baptist Church but later, along with her daughter, joined Fourth Mt. Zion Baptist Church in Crewe, VA.
In her teenage years, Tee Tee loved to do hair.  Her profound talent earned her 2nd place in a hair competition at the Virginia State Fair.
Tee Tee was a people person.  She loved everyone she came in contact with.  She was a devoted friend and would go out of her way to help anyone.  “Punkin”, as she referred to everyone, would leave you in tears from her jokes and sense of humor.
Tee Tee leaves to cherish her precious memory:  her babies that she loved so much, ReNalyia Knight and Deveon Foster of Crewe, VA; her mother, Reba K. Berkley of Newport News, VA; step-mother, Pearl Knight of Crewe, VA; three brothers Mercedes and Siyani Knight of Crewe, VA and Thaddeus McCain of Burkeville, VA; two sisters, Barbara Berkley and Hermenia (Artric) Tucker of Blackstone, Va; three aunts, Sandra Justice of Newport News, VA, Barbara Faulk of Crewe, VA and Celeste (Fred) Lewis of Maryland; two uncles Matthew Knight of Crewe, VA and Warren Knight of Philadelphia, PA; two great aunts, Ida Rather and Thelma Rather of Crewe, VA; eight nephews; two nieces; devoted “Aunts”, Edith (Merrial) Shelton and Daisy “Margo” (Frank) Seward; devoted best friend, Tiarna “Suga” Bland of Crewe, VA; and a host of cousins and friends.
Funeral Services for Ms. LaKisha Knight will be held Wednesday, October 28, 2015 at 1:00 p.m. at Dominion Worship Center, Crewe with interment to follow in the Knight Family Cemetery, Crewe.

Viewing will be Tuesday from 11:00 a.m. until 8:00 p.m. at the funeral home.

Donations may be made toward funeral expenses to W.E. Hawkes & Son Funeral Home.

W.E. Hawkes & Son Funeral Home of Blackstone in charge of arrangements.
